[edit] What is the MIS Practicum Lab and When is it scheduled?

The MIS Practicum Lab (BMIS 2999) is the version of the IS Practicum that first-year MBA/MS-MIS students should register for. It is scheduled in the Fall semester and meets at the same time and place as the 3 credit MIS Practicum course (BMIS 2056).

[edit] Who should be registered for the Practicum (and how)?

All MS-MIS and MBA/MS-MIS Dual Degree students must complete the MIS Practicum prior to graduation.

[edit] Full-Time MBA/MS-MIS Students

  • First-year Full-Time MBA/MS-MIS Students should be registered for BMIS 2999 during the Fall semester.
  • Second-year Full-Time MBA/MS-MIS Students should be registered for BMIS 2056 during the Fall semester.

[edit] All other MS-MIS or MBA/MS-MIS students

All other students must take the MIS Practicum (BMIS 2056) prior to graduating. This includes:

  • Full-time MS-MIS students
  • Part-time MBA/MS-MIS
  • Part-time MS-MIS students

NOTE: The MIS Practicum is only offered in the Fall Semester. As a result part-time and one-year (i.e. Full time MS-MIS students) must plan ahead to ensure that they can meet this requirement.

[edit] Exemption from BMIS 2411 and leaving the MBA/MS-MIS program

If a student drops the dual degree after a few weeks or term or two, at what point have they taken enough MIS courses to fulfill the Information Systems requirement?

The policy (and intention) is that a student completing the [MS-MIS Curriculum | MS-MIS Core classes]] is exempted from the requirement to take BMIS 2411. Therefore, if a student leaves the MBA/MS-MIS program prior to completing these courses they may have to take BMIS 2411 to satisfy their MBA requirements.
